Hmmm...wonder what the requirement for Coins and Bracelets will be...
Bracelets September 2022
Ch. 1 -
Ch. 2 -
Ch. 3 - 520
Ch. 4 - 1830
Ch. 5 - 4.4k
Ch. 6 - 6.8k
Ch. 7 - 9.4k
Ch. 8 - 13k
Ch. 9 - 18k
Ch. 10 - 24k
Ch. 11 - 30k
Ch. 12 - 40k
Ch. 13 - 49 k
Ch. 14 - 58k
Ch. 15 - 67k
Ch. 16 - 72k
Ch. 17 - 77k
Ch. 18 - 87k
Ch. 19 -101k
Ch. 20 - 118k

New Sack of Coins value September 2022
The amounts were decreased, compared to the previous FA in Live Worlds, but increased compared to the last FA in Beta.
These values are about ⅔ of those we saw in the previous FA in the Live Worlds
Ch. 1 -
Ch. 2 -
Ch. 3 - 264k
Ch. 4 - 504k
Ch. 5 - 924k
Ch. 6 - 1344k
Ch. 7 - 1984k
Ch. 8 - 2784k
Ch. 9 - 3696k
Ch. 10 - 4704k
Ch. 11 - 5920k
Ch. 12 - 7296k
Ch. 13 - 8856k
Ch. 14 - 10608k
Ch. 15 - 11856k
Ch. 16 - 13672k
Ch. 17 - 15632K
Ch. 18 - 18608k
Ch. 19 - 24448k
Ch. 20 - 32088k

For this FA, I am fortunate to have just finished a chapter, so I have lots of space to deploy lots of little buildings. For the previous FA, I finished the chapter during the course of the FA. What I found was, the game did not adjust my chapter dependent badges - coins, bracelets and guards - to account for me progressing to a new chapter.

My point is, it appears that it is worth delaying the start of a new chapter until after then FA begins. Once the FA begins, then you can begin the new chapter. This allows to craft lots of chapter-upgraded buildings (such as Mana Sawmills) to earn Vision Vapour (Arcane Residue) but not be penalized with more difficult badge requirements.
 

Enevhar Aldarion

Oh Wise One
What I found was, the game did not adjust my chapter dependent badges - coins, bracelets and guards - to account for me progressing to a new chapter.

It is supposed to and I have had it happen to me. So when you say you finished a chapter during the FA, did you only finish the final research of that chapter or the first research, usually Advanced Scouts, at the start of the next chapter? Because the game does not count you in the new chapter until you finish that first research.
 

Deleted User - 849411552

Guest
I finished the first research, which meant that I was then crafting at the new chapter level - I was definitely in the new chapter. Yes, I was surprised when this happened that it didn't affect the badge requirements. Of course I was monitoring the badge requirements very closely during the last FA because of the huge jump in coin and bracelet targets.

I guess I won't know if it was some kind of one-time bug, or perhaps a chapter related bug (Chapter 14 in this case), until I try this strategy with the upcoming FA. I will post in this thread if it doesn't work out.
